Summary

Under the direction of the Tram Operations Supervisor and/or Tram Operator, attendant is responsible for loading/unloading passengers on/off an aerial tramway cabin. Attendants also perform cabin attendant duties inside the cabin during passenger transport.

Job Duties
  • On a daily or shift basis, and in accordance with GATI's policies & procedures and in accordance with all ANSI B-77 guidelines, is the sole cabin attendant and/or platform or station attendant who is responsible for the safe and orderly traffic of passengers on/off an aerial tramway cabin.
  • Advises and assists passengers.
  • Maintains surveillance of his/her jurisdiction; has authority to stop the movement of the cabin when entering the loading dock, whenever wind conditions or another condition/situation might cause damage to the cabin or danger to the passengers.
  • Advise the Tram Operator in charge of the control room of any abnormal or unusual occurrences, conditions or adverse weather conditions; if an abnormal or unusual condition develops in which continued operation may endanger passenger safety or adversely affect the safety of the operation, the Tram Attendant should respond by choosing an appropriate action, which may include any of the following:
  • Assisting the passenger;
  • Immediately stopping the aerial tram and advise the Tram Operator.
  • Continuing operation and observation;
  • Deny access to the aerial tramway to any person; using procedures and criteria provided.
  • Keeps current on training received on operating procedures related to enclosed cabins, loading/unloading, control center communications and customer service interaction.
  • Knowledge or willingness to learn on proper use of manual switches under his/her control; load limits; passenger capacity; emergency evacuation equipment and procedures, and applicable safety procedures.
  • Coordinate with the janitorial staff, shall practice good housekeeping, with particular emphasis on preventing the development of any condition contributing to personal injury; tasks might include cabin cleaning, window cleaning and/or loading area vacuuming/sweeping/mopping.
  • Might receive daily guidance, training or work assignments from the shift Tram Supervisor in the absence of the Tram Operations Manager.
  • Recognize and communicate, immediately, problems that would interfere with the safe operation of the tram.
  • Knowledge or willingness to learn how to follow emergency evacuation procedures, handle emergency or stressful situations in a calm manner, and assist with evacuating the cabin.
